The EIC's Forgotten War: The First Anglo-Maratha War
from The East India Company: The Corporation That Conquered Nations — Fexingo History · host Fexingo
We explore the First Anglo-Maratha War (1775–1782), a conflict that nearly destroyed the East India Company. Lucas and Luna dive into the Treaty of Surat, the Battle of Wadgaon, and the unlikely hero—Mahadji Shinde—who turned the Maratha Confederacy into a formidable power. We talk about the Company's overreach, the role of the Bombay government, and the Treaty of Salbai that reset relations. Along the way, we meet Raghunathrao, Nana Phadnavis, and Warren Hastings, who had to clean up a mess he didn't start.
